EVZ Limited (ASX: $EVZ) has secured a major contract in the mining and industrial sector through its subsidiary, Brockman Engineering. The contract, valued at approximately $23M, involves the design and procurement of bulk process water tanks for the seawater desalination project at Parker Point, Dampier, awarded by Rio Tinto.

The project is anticipated to commence immediately with a planned mobilisation to site in December 2024 and expected completion in the last quarter of 2025. This contract is expected to contribute to EVZ Limited's revenue and earnings in FY25 and FY26, aligning with the company's strategy of diversifying its project portfolio across the Energy & Resources sectors.
